About the role
- Support us in expanding our training portfolio to include outpatient supported living and specialized residential settings: We have a clear roadmap and are looking for academic authors who can contribute their expertise to the content expansion and further development of our offerings in these areas.
- Together we want to support staff working in these fields to perform their demanding and responsible roles with sound professional knowledge and practical relevance.
- Curriculum and topic development: You will participate in the joint creation and further development of a curriculum or topic structure for the stated areas.
- Thorough literature research: You will conduct comprehensive research into current literature as well as evidence-based methods and best practices.
- Creation of practice-oriented training content: You will develop subject-specific learning materials for the target group based on existing concepts or collaboratively developed frameworks.
- Editing/proofreading: You will revise existing texts both linguistically and technically.
- Quality assurance: You will ensure clear and accurate presentation of content and make sure texts are linguistically flawless and technically correct.
- Development of learning content: You will actively contribute to the strategic development of our training courses by identifying industry-specific trends and best practices and integrating them into the courses.
Requirements
- Professional qualification: You hold a degree or comparable professional qualification, e.g., in social work, social pedagogy, special education, education science, psychology, medicine, nursing or a related field.
- Practical experience: Practical experience in outpatient supported living, specialized residential settings, integration assistance, or a related social or care field is explicitly desired. Experience working with people with disabilities or mental health conditions is particularly relevant.
- Language skills: You have excellent written and verbal communication skills and a strong sense for user-friendly, target-group-appropriate text presentation.
- Quality awareness: You work precisely and with attention to detail, ensuring all content meets the highest professional and linguistic standards.
- Conscientiousness: You have a strong sense of responsibility and the ability to work accurately and independently, adhering to agreements and deadlines.
- Team and organizational skills: You will work closely with our product development team and other team members.
